The data was collected … Webb18 aug. 2024 · Rating scales. Schutte’s Emotional Intelligence Scale (SEIS) is a well established self report instrument to measure trait emotional intelligence . It comprises of 33 items, 3 of which are reverse scored. Participants respond on a 5 point Likert scale ranging from strongly disagree (=1) to strongly agree (=5).
